[Beauty Review] Shiseido Aqualabel Collagen GL Cream






Hello there you!

Just the other day, I was invited to a ZA event, where they co-introduced this product above - Aqualabel Collagen GL Cream. Didn't really had a great test of it only until recently. What was introduced was that the product works like a sleeping mask.

About the Product:
It has a five-in-one formula with high amounts of concentrated collagen! Can be used as a lotion (the japanese way of a toner), as a emulsion, essence, cream and mask all at once! What it promises is that the product has the ability to penetrated deeper into the skin layers and deliver moisture as well as effective ingredients into the skin!

How it really feels:
It has a very unique kind of gel/jelly texture. You know how some cream product can turn out to be a tad bit messy in the container that these beauty products usually come from? Well, no worry for over flowing or whats-not. This product forms back, and make the bottle look new again! love that technology. (details +++ points)

Upon picking the product up from the bottle, it feels light, soft,and upon application - all i have to say is that IT IS NOT STICKY AT ALL!! Major love for that please! I can feel the difference right after 3 nights of usage. Crazy or what. This is going to be on one of my skin care regime (I'm very lazy at night, so the best thing I can ask for is a ALL-IN-ONE product that allows my face to benefit from)

Would I recommend it?:
Definitely yes. For the price you pay, and the benefits that tags along with it, I think it is definitely worth every dime! 

Retail Price:
$33.50

[Travelogue] 2D1N Johor Bahru: KSL Resort Hotel + Legoland Malaysia

Hello there lovelies!

So over the weekend, monster and I decided that we should get a short weekend trip. And since the place that we were going were almost everywhere in the ads recently, we thought to ourselves "how could we possibly miss it?"

Or more like, "I WANT TO GO LEH" (LEH-GO-LAND). Hahaha. So instead of getting a deal off deals.com.sg and etc, I decided to do it my way, and also use up my points that i chalked up with agoda.com. Yep, and we made a booking with agoda.com and landed ourselves on a friday night, after almost 1 hour of jam at the custom in KSL Resort Hotel for $80sgd (actual price $94 + taxes). 


Superior King, 15th Floor, Smoking Room (asked for a non smoking, but they only had a queen + single which wasn't what we wanted, but thankfully the room didn't smell of smoke)


In the middle of the night, I think there was a problem with the aircon no matter how hard we tried to adjust the temperature, it kept staying at 24 - 25 degrees




I think they should offer me conditioner. I don't think most of us would need the body lotion?




the water flow was good, but the hot water wasn't hot enough for my preference.
The booking also came with complimentary breakfast for ourselves. Unlike what other reviewers said, I think the breakfast was rather ok? I wasn't expecting a lot, cause I'm not really a breakfast person, but when we went there, at about 9.50am, the restaurant wasn't very pack and the waiters were all efficient in guiding us in and clearing our plates.













So right after we were done with breakfast. We went to process our check out, collect his car. Oh, if you're driving, I strongly advise valet parking. But one thing to note is that it is 20MYR per entry, per day. So lets say if you were going to check in, you pay 20MYR, after that, you drive out and come back again, that requires another 20MYR. But we managed to pay just 25MYR for doing that. Just learn to be nice (: 



After an almost 30 minutes drive


Queuing for our tickets. To my surprise, so many people were buying annual passes, I dont know for what, but I had 30% off my actual tickets, so for two, we paid $196 MYR
 So the bottom few are some of the significant art pieces that I saw, and thought was picture worthy...










Overall, I would say that Legoland was just a place for you and your family to take photos. It was more like an exhibition of what all the great builders of these legobricks have achieved. Maybe when the whole water theme park and the hotel has been completed, then would I decide to go over and have a look at the place again. 

There were only a few rides that were available, and they are all very child-friendly. I didn't take any because, I'm not really a rides person plus the fact that they didn't look interesting. I really feel that, honestly, that USS is wayyyyy better. I mean, I did take the rides in USS, and not just once (I have yet taken the battlestar and transformers ride), but that being said, you should roughly know the comparison already.

So yes, I will still say, wait till the entire place has finished all its constructions and that the highway has better signs and posters to lead the way, then maybe, you can consider going. But better to follow a tour bus, than to drive up, cause it can be rather tiring. Especially when you're new to the place.
